1 f(x) = 3x + 4 g(x) = x + 10 h(x) = x2

(a) Work out fg(x)


Give your answer in the form ax + b where a and b are integers

fg(x) =
(2)

(b) Work out gf(x)


Give your answer in the form ax + b where a and b are integers

gf(x) =
(2)
(a) Work out gh(x)

gh(x) =
(1)
(Total for Question 1 is 5 marks)
